What's the safest online payment?

By and large, credit cards are easily the most secure and safe payment method to use when you shop online. Credit cards use online security features like encryption and fraud monitoring to keep your accounts and personal information safe.

Does PayPal refund money if scammed?

You have 180 days from the payment date to open a dispute. In a dispute, you can message the seller through PayPal to try to resolve any issues. If you cannot resolve the dispute, you have 20 days to escalate the dispute to a claim. In a claim, we investigate the case and decide the outcome.

Which is safer, Zelle or Venmo?

Both of the payment services are decently safe, have user-friendly interfaces, and allow you to conveniently send money when you need it. Zelle stands out from Venmo with its absence of instant transfer fees, but it also cannot be used as a wallet. So, if you need a wallet function, you should go for Venmo .

What's safer, Zelle or PayPal?

Zelle and PayPal security and privacy standards are fairly similar in that both platforms make use of encryption, strict access controls, and two-factor authentication. In addition, both platforms allow customers to make payments using their email address, which protects their account and personal information.

What is safer, Cash App or Venmo?

While both Venmo and Cash App are highly encrypted and pride themselves on safely securing personal user data, Cash App takes it one step further by requiring a one-time login code every time a user logs into their account that they can only access with their smartphone.

Is Zelle a safe payment method?

Zelle® does not offer purchase protection, so pay it safe. Only send money to people you personally know and trust. 4. Confirm your recipient's contact information: Make sure you have the correct U.S. mobile phone number or email address for the person you want to send money to.

Is PayPal the safest way to pay online?

Paying through PayPal is about as safe as paying using a credit card, but there are indirect advantages to using PayPal. Merchants won't see your credit card information if you use PayPal, for example, thus reducing the risk of data exposure.

What is the best payment to not get scammed?

Credit cards offer features like encryption and fraud protection to help keep your personal information secure. In addition, credit card users are protected by federal law and can only be liable for up to $50 on fraudulent chargers.

Are checks safer than credit cards?

Checks don't offer the same protection as credit cards.

If a thief steals money from your checking account, you must report the fraud within 2 days, or you could be on the hook for up to $500 of the fraudulent transactions. And if you don't report the fraud within 60 days, you could be liable for every penny.

Will Zelle refund money if scammed?

How to Get Your Money Back. Zelle is processing each scam claim they receive on a case-by-case basis. If you haven't already done so, file a claim directly with Zelle through their app or by phone (844-428-8542). You'll also need to file a claim with the bank or credit union your funds were taken.

Why people prefer Zelle over Venmo?

In general, Zelle is better if the only thing you're looking for is a fast, free way to send money. Venmo can do the same thing, but it takes slightly longer to move money into your bank account unless you pay a fee to speed things up.

What are the cons of PayPal?

Despite the benefits, businesses should be aware of PayPal transaction fees, account freezes, lack of customization options, high currency conversion fees, and the possibility of chargebacks.

What is the downside of using Zelle?

Unlike many money transfer apps, Zelle does not charge a fee for instant transfers. Zelle transfers are generally secure, but the app does carry risks, including the risk of glitches at banks that can affect money transfers.
